Monodilepas diemenensis

Monodilepas diemenensis

NameMonodilepas diemenensis
Scientific NameMonodilepas diemenensis
Common NameTasmanian Keyhole Limpet
FamilyFissurellidae
GenusMonodilepas
Speciesdiemenensis
Geographic DistributionEndemic to Tasmania, Australia.
Habitatsubtidal
Average Size (mm)10-25
Identifying FeaturesThe most distinctive feature is the large, central, oval apical perforation. The shell is relatively flat and exhibits concentric growth lines.
Raritycommon
Author Citation(Finlay, 1927)

Description

Monodilepas diemenensis is a species of keyhole limpet, characterized by its distinctive oval, depressed shell with a prominent central apical perforation. It is endemic to the waters around Tasmania, Australia, where it inhabits subtidal rocky environments.
